An Athletic Appetite

We will be starting a new feature this week called An Athletic Appetite. Team food expert Caitie Van Wormer will be reviewing the best places to eat in Turlock and there are lots of them! Enjoy!

The #1 place to eat this week is PANERA. They have a variety of food that is not only reasonably priced but they also have something delicious for any time of the day, breakfast, lunch, and dinner. Not to mention, the food is also quite healthy. I recommend the “pick any two” option with broccoli cheddar soup and your choice of a salad, sandwich, or a hot painini.

Coming in at our #2 spot is the TACO BUS. If you are in the mood for some authentic Mexican food this is the place to go. They have great menu and the prices are relatively cheap, the food is similar to the Taco Truck’s just not as spicy. I recommend the quesadilla supreme with carne asada or the tacos and of course your choice of drink.

Last but certainly not least at #3 is CHINA CAFÉ. They have a large selection of some great Chinese classics. The prices are considerably cheap especially for the amount of food that they give you (large portions). I would recommend the orange chicken, broccoli beef, with chicken chow mein and pork fried rice, or the walnut shrimp special is also quite delicious.
